Key Attractions
Sandakphu, standing tall at 3,636 meters, is the highest point in West Bengal and one of the trek’s key attractions. From this vantage point, trekkers can witness the majestic Himalayan peaks, including Mount Everest (8,848 meters), Kanchenjunga (8,586 meters), Lhotse (8,516 meters), and Makalu (8,481 meters). The diverse scenery along the trek encompasses agricultural fields, dense forests, and alpine ridges, offering a captivating mix of landscapes. Plus, the trek provides opportunities to spot wildlife such as Red Panda, Himalayan black bear, leopard, pangolin, wild boar, and a variety of bird species. Interacting with local mountain villages and residents also adds a cultural element to the trekking experience.

Wildlife Sightings
Along the Sandakphu Singalila Ridge Trek, trekkers may spot an array of wildlife indigenous to the Himalayan region.
Some of the potential sightings include:
- The elusive Red Panda, a small arboreal mammal known for its distinct red and black fur.
- The imposing Himalayan Black Bear, a powerful omnivore that inhabits the dense forests.
- The stealthy Leopard, a skilled predator capable of navigating the rugged terrain with ease.
Other species that may be encountered include the shy Pangolin, the agile Wild Boar, and a diverse array of avian life.
The trek’s diverse landscapes provide a habitat for this rich wildlife, making it an exceptional destination for nature enthusiasts.

The Sandakphu Singalila Ridge Trek begins with a drive from Darjeeling to Rimbeek, where trekkers embark on a 10-kilometer hike to Gurdum.
The next day, they trek 13 kilometers to Sandakphu, the highest point in West Bengal at 3,636 meters.
On the third day, trekkers descend 21 kilometers to Phalut.
The journey continues with:
- A 14-kilometer trek from Phalut to Gorkhey.
- A 15-kilometer trek from Gorkhey to Timburey.
- A final 5-kilometer trek from Timburey to Srikhola, followed by a drive back to Darjeeling.
Throughout the trek, trekkers witness stunning views of Everest, Kanchenjunga, Lhotse, and Makalu, as well as diverse landscapes and potential wildlife sightings.

Health Considerations
The Sandakphu Singalila Ridge Trek isn’t suitable for children under 2, people with diabetes, those prone to altitude sickness, or individuals over 70 years old.
To ensure a safe and enjoyable experience, it’s crucial to consider your health and fitness level before embarking on this trek. Participants should be aware of the following:
-
Altitude Considerations: The trek reaches an elevation of 3,636 meters, which may cause altitude sickness in some individuals. Proper acclimatization and monitoring are essential.
-
Fitness Level: This trek requires a moderate level of physical fitness, as it involves long days of hiking with significant elevation gains.
-
Medical Conditions: Individuals with pre-existing medical conditions, such as diabetes or heart problems, should consult their healthcare providers before signing up for the trek.
Packing Essentials
When preparing for the Sandakphu Singalila Ridge Trek, participants should ensure they pack the essential items to make the most of their adventure.
Warm clothing, including thermal layers, hats, gloves, and sturdy, broken-in hiking boots are a must. Plus, be sure to bring a reusable water bottle, high-energy snacks, personal toiletries, and any necessary medications.
Trekkers should also pack a lightweight rain jacket, sunscreen, and sunglasses to protect against the elements.
Don’t forget your passport or ID, cash, and travel insurance documents.
